The history of Knight Frank
The Early Years 1896-1911
Founded in 1896, Knight Frank & Rutley began as a valuations, surveying and auctions business. Our first sale takes place in London, and we make a name for ourselves by selling the iconic Crystal Palace to Lord Plymouth for £210,000.
Making History 1912-1927
Cecil Chubb buys Stonehenge, Winston Churchill buys Chartwell and The Duke of Westminster sells Grosvenor House, all through Knight Frank & Rutley. We advise on the site assembly of the landmark BBC Broadcasting House in London.
From London, to Lancashire, to Lagos 1928-1965
We sell the majority of Lytham St Anne’s in Lancashire and the historic Fountains Abbey in Yorkshire. Our ambitions drift to new horizons. We open a Geneva office, and establish a presence in Nigeria.
International Growth 1966-1996
We establish joint ventures in New York, Hong Kong and Singapore. The strength of our international partnerships grows, and in 1996, ‘Rutley’ is dropped from our name. Knight Frank as you know it is born.
The Olympics 1997-2005
In 2003, we become a Limited Liability Partnership, and the year after we’re ranked as one of The Sunday Times 100 Best UK Companies to Work For. Seizing a once in a generation opportunity, we advise on the development of London’s 2012 Olympic Village.
Baker Street Beginnings 2005-2020
Our reach expands to more than 165 offices in 36 countries across six continents. We move to our global HQ in Baker Street, London, and are appointed as the agent for the Empire State Building, and The Shard, the tallest landmark building in Europe.
Present: 125 Years and Counting
We celebrated 125 years of Knight Frank in 2021, forming a global partnership with US based commercial real estate firm Cresa. My Knight Frank launches: a library of research publications celebrating our legacy and our future.
